publisher: World Bank Publications publish date: June 15th 2010
format: ebook
language: English
ISBN:
0821380753 (9780821380758)
publisher: World Bank Publications publish date: July 1st 2010
format: paperback pages: 336
language: English
ISBN:
0821380745 (9780821380741)